Output 6e957401251c617875dde4c756a6dd05a413956b53d3c2d3b5373f7a7811b0fd:2

value
132849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c035f7033ea0be6f132a7730e221db5ad5a8714 OP_EQUAL
address
3QfYFEPcbuYWCfDUBnLLhSVzPfVtWFAUUo
transaction
6e957401251c617875dde4c756a6dd05a413956b53d3c2d3b5373f7a7811b0fd
spent
true